1. Soft-Glow Crescent Mirrors for Gentle Harmony

Imagine a serene, airy nook where a curved mirror catches the first morning light and whispers balance. This concept leans into soft curves, breathable textiles, and a tranquil palette.
Color Palette
- Warm neutrals: taupe, ivory, and soft blush
- Accents in oat, sand, and pale sage
Key Pieces
- Dreamy crescent mirror with a light wood frame
- Low-profile platform bed with linen bedding
- Natural jute rug and lightweight drapery
Styling Tips
- Place the mirror where it reflects soft morning light to invite good chi
- Keep surfaces clutter-free and add a couple of potted greens
Vibe: this look feels airy, breathable, and grounding. Ideal for a master retreat or a guest room that still reads as “calm.”
2. Mirror Gallery Alchemy: Balanced Angles and Calm Blues

Who says a mirror has to be one big reflective slab? Create a mini gallery wall using mirrors of different shapes to invite flow and soften edges. Think ocean blues, matte metals, and curated simplicity.
Color Palette
- Soft blues and seafoam greens
- Warm brass and matte black accents
Key Pieces
- Assorted mirrors: square, oval, a quirky sunburst
- Low, dark wood dresser or console
- Slim, architectural pendant lighting
Hint: group mirrors at eye level to visually extend the room without crowding it. This vibe is for art lovers who crave balance without stiffness.

5. Crystal-Clear Morning Flow: Transparent Polycarbonate Accent

If you crave lightness, go for a transparent or highly reflective surface. A crystal-clear mirror creates a sense of space and keeps the room from feeling blocked.
Color Palette
- Bright whites and airy beiges
- Hints of pale blush and soft gray
Key Pieces
- Wall-mounted glass mirror or freestanding acrylic frame
- Glossy nightstands or glass-topped tables
- Airy sheer curtains
Tip: avoid overcrowding with too many pieces around the mirror; let the reflection do the talking. This vibe is ideal for small spaces or rooms that need to feel instantly lighter.
